Jerome bought a shirt and paid $4.29 in tax. The shoes had a sticker price of $57.20. What percent sales tax did he pay?

Answer:   7.5%

Explanation:

Divide the amount of tax paid over the sticker price.

4.29/57.20 = 0.075 which converts to 7.5% when you move the decimal point 2 spots to the right.

Alternatively, you can multiply 0.075 by 100 to get 7.5%
